Output 5236648a62dc3bbd13859dd9c3bfb5eae3d2248856d502e6bc4860e5502405d2:0

value
158640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08c2b4b86667586784d464af21f7313da7c01fd8 OP_EQUAL
address
32VLaV34cySha1zAJbvFmUcAxvuKcBQn5a
transaction
5236648a62dc3bbd13859dd9c3bfb5eae3d2248856d502e6bc4860e5502405d2
spent
true